How Much Does an Investment Real Estate Agent Make in Texas?

Updated May 28, 2024
Filter

Individually reported data submitted by users of our website

Normal Confidence
$57,653/yr
Average Base Pay
Low $49,377
Average $57,653
High $67,195
The average salary for Investment Real Estate Agent is $57,653 per year in Texas.

Top 10 Highest Paying Cities For Investment Real Estate Agent Jobs in Texas

It is important to understand how location impacts your career prospects in the United States. There are some cities where an Investment Real Estate Agent can find a job easily with a greater salary paid then achieve a higher standard of living. Below is the top cities list for Investment Real Estate Agent job salaries in Texas. Some cities can pay higher salaries for Investment Real Estate Agent jobs, which can indicate that there is a large demand for Investment Real Estate Agent positions in this city.
The following table shows top 10 cities where the Investment Real Estate Agent salary is higher than other cities in Texas. Houston takes first place in this list, followed by Pasadena, Galveston. The Investment Real Estate Agent salary is $59,066 in Houston, which is higher than the national average. There is 1 city's Investment Real Estate Agent salary higher than national average in Texas.
The average salary for an Investment Real Estate Agent in Texas is $57,653, but we found that the city with the highest salary for Investment Real Estate Agent jobs is Houston, TX, and it is higher than Pasadena. Investment Real Estate Agent jobs in Houston can have the opportunity to earn higher salaries than in other cities in Texas.
CITY ANNUAL SALARY MONTHLY PAY WEEKLY PAY HOURLY WAGE
Houston $59,066 $4,922 $1,136 $28
Pasadena $58,831 $4,903 $1,131 $28
Galveston $58,772 $4,898 $1,130 $28
Austin $58,301 $4,858 $1,121 $28
Dallas $58,124 $4,844 $1,118 $28
Plano $58,124 $4,844 $1,118 $28
Carrollton $58,124 $4,844 $1,118 $28
Garland $58,124 $4,844 $1,118 $28
Irving $58,124 $4,844 $1,118 $28
Richardson $58,124 $4,844 $1,118 $28

Frequently Asked Questions About an Investment Real Estate Agent Salaries

What is the average of an Investment Real Estate Agent in Texas?

The Investment Real Estate Agent salary range is from $49,377 to $67,195, and the average Investment Real Estate Agent salary is $57,653/year in Texas. The Investment Real Estate Agent's salary will change in different locations.

Which location pays the highest Investment Real Estate Agent salary in the United States?

The Investment Real Estate Agent salary in San Jose, CA is $73,906 which is the highest in the US.

What kinds of reasons will influence the Investment Real Estate Agent's salary?

Besides the location, employees' education degree, related skills, and work experience also will influence the salary. Try to improve your skills and experience to get a higher salary for the position of Investment Real Estate Agent.
